The Muslim Dogra of India

The Muslim Dogra of India, numbering approximately 241,000 people, are Engaged yet Unreached.
They are described as a community of India .
They are an Indigenous people, with Dogra as their ethnic/kinship group and are in the Punjabi people cluster of the South Asian Peoples.
Their primary religion is Islam - Sunni.
They primarily speak Dogri.
